Question:
Hello, Im looking for hubs to fit a 3/4 inch straight spindle for an old boat trailer. Thanks.
asked by: Ross K
Expert Reply:
Hello Ross, thanks for reaching out. We do carry the 3/4" ID bearings part # TMK36FR, but I am sorry to say we do not offer a hub for a 3/4" straight spindle. That spindle size is now obsolete, and I am not aware of any hubs made in that size. Unless you can find something used/secondhand, parts for that may be impossible to find.
In this case the next step would be to look at replacing the spindles, or replacing the axle entirely with something more modern.
